Integrating Advanced Analytics and Big Data

The integration of advanced analytics and Big Data into market research practices stands as a cornerstone strategy for forecasting consumer trends. In today's data-driven world, the sheer volume of information available offers unprecedented opportunities for insights. However, the challenge lies in sifting through this vast data to extract meaningful patterns and predictions. Organizations can employ advanced analytics tools and techniques, such as machine learning algorithms and predictive modeling, to analyze consumer data effectively. These tools can identify trends, preferences, and behaviors from various data sources, including social media, purchase history, and online behavior.

For example, a report by McKinsey highlights how leading retailers are using advanced analytics to predict future buying behaviors, enabling them to personalize marketing efforts and optimize inventory levels. By analyzing historical purchase data and social media trends, these retailers can forecast demand for specific products with remarkable accuracy. This approach not only enhances customer satisfaction but also significantly reduces waste and increases profitability.

Furthermore, the integration of Big Data analytics allows organizations to conduct sentiment analysis, monitor brand perception in real-time, and predict shifts in consumer attitudes. This comprehensive view of the consumer landscape is invaluable for Strategic Planning and Decision Making, enabling organizations to anticipate market changes and adapt their strategies accordingly.

Leveraging Consumer Segmentation and Persona Development

Consumer segmentation and persona development are critical for understanding the nuances of the target market and predicting future trends. By dividing the market into distinct segments based on demographics, psychographics, buying behavior, and other relevant criteria, organizations can gain deeper insights into the preferences and needs of different consumer groups. This targeted approach enables more accurate predictions of consumer trends, as it considers the specific characteristics and behaviors of each segment.

Accenture's research underscores the importance of personalized experiences, noting that 91% of consumers are more likely to shop with brands that recognize, remember, and provide relevant offers and recommendations. By developing detailed consumer personas, organizations can tailor their products, services, and marketing strategies to meet the unique needs of each segment, enhancing engagement and loyalty.

Moreover, consumer segmentation and persona development facilitate the identification of emerging trends within specific groups, allowing organizations to capitalize on new opportunities or address potential challenges proactively. This strategic focus on tailored experiences and offerings is essential for maintaining relevance and competitiveness in a rapidly changing market.

Embracing Agile Research Methodologies

Agile research methodologies offer another effective strategy for harnessing the predictive power of market research. In contrast to traditional, lengthy market research processes, agile methodologies prioritize speed, flexibility, and iterative learning. This approach allows organizations to quickly gather consumer insights, test hypotheses, and refine their understanding of emerging trends in real-time. Agile research methodologies often involve rapid surveys, A/B testing, and continuous feedback loops, enabling organizations to stay closely aligned with consumer needs and preferences.

For instance, Google's adoption of agile research practices has enabled it to rapidly innovate and respond to consumer trends. By continuously testing new features and gathering user feedback, Google can refine its offerings and anticipate market demands effectively. This iterative process ensures that products and services remain relevant and highly attuned to consumer expectations.

Furthermore, agile research methodologies foster a culture of innovation and adaptability within organizations. By encouraging experimentation and learning from failure, organizations can more effectively anticipate consumer trends and pivot their strategies as needed. This proactive approach to market research and Strategic Planning is crucial for navigating the complexities of the modern marketplace.
